A Powerful 25:1 Reduction in Waste Volume
Even with its small footprint and solar-powered operation, the P200 delivers big results. Facilities see up to a 25:1 reduction in waste volume, allowing teams to:
-
Dramatically cut hauling frequency
-
Reduce waste-handling labor
-
Maintain cleaner, safer work areas
-
Increase recycling revenue
-
Improve back-of-house workflow
The full charge on the solar P200 provide an amazing system runtime of 22.5 hours, cycling every 5 minutes, completing 385 cycles.
